WebThe STATCOM consists of a single VSC and its associated shunt-connected transformer. The STATCOM capability is similar to that of the rotating synchronous condenser or static VAR compensator (SVC) and is typically used for providing reactive power compensation for voltage support (IEEE Power Engineering Society FACTS Application Task Force, 1996). ERCOT installed two synchronous condensers (each +175/−125 MVA) at 345 kV level to offer reactive power support to Panhandle region and enhance the power system strength in April 2024. The estimated Panhandle export limit improvement is 250 MW [2]. WebA synchronous motor can be used to improve the overall power factor of an electrical system by adjusting the DC excitation. The synchronous motor used specifically for power factor improvement without any mechanical load is called a synchronous condenser. The synchronous condenser is used in parallel with the load to improve the power factor.
